The Rain-Hit Thriller in Guwahati

Before we talk about that magical six, let's set the scene. The match was taking place in Guwahati, and the weather was playing games. Rain delayed the start by over two and a half hours, and eventually, the match was reduced to just 11 overs per side.

In an 11-over match, there is absolutely no time to settle down. You can't just take singles and wait for the bad balls. Every single ball is an event. Mumbai Indians captain Hardik Pandya won the toss and decided to bowl first. He probably thought his world-class bowlers like Bumrah and Trent Boult would easily restrict the Rajasthan Royals in such a short game. But Rajasthan’s openers, Yashasvi Jaiswal and Vaibhav Sooryavanshi, walked out to the middle with one clear goal: pure destruction.

Taking Down the Rest of the Attack

If you thought he was going to stop after attacking Bumrah, you are wrong. The next over was bowled by Trent Boult, another absolute legend known for destroying top orders. Vaibhav didn't care about reputations. He launched a six off Boult too!

He then went after Shardul Thakur, smashing him for two sixes and a four. He was hitting the ball so cleanly that it looked like a video game. Eventually, Shardul got him out, caught by Tilak Varma. But by then, the damage was completely done.

Vaibhav walked back to the pavilion after scoring a blazing 39 runs off just 14 balls. His strike rate was an unbelievable 278.57! He hit 5 sixes and a four in that super short, highly entertaining knock. Thanks to his fearless start, and Jaiswal's unbeaten 77, Rajasthan Royals posted a massive total of 150 for 3 in just 11 overs.
